        If you're getting off at the BART Embarcadero station, several good options, depending on how fancy/dressy/expensive you would like:

        - Boulevard (classic high-end Californian)
        - One Market (Bradley Ogden's @ 1 Market)
        - Ozumo (interesting Japanese-ish)
        - Perbacco (nice Italian)
        - Tadich Grill (classic SF)
        - Sens (upstairs in Embarcadero) - nice modern Mediterranean (?)

        All of these are within a 1-2 block walk, easy with suitcases if they are rollers or not too heavy.

        Most should be open for lunch, but hit OpenTable for these downtown spots and you can see what's available in the Financial District.
